Everything you need to know about gravel delivery in Oxford.
Homeowners and contractors in Oxford typically order a mix of gravel, sand, dirt, and stone for driveways, patios, drainage, and garden beds. Each material serves different needs: crushed stone for compaction and structure, sand for leveling and bedding, dirt for grading and topsoil projects, and larger stone for drainage or decorative uses. Choose based on the project’s load, drainage needs, and desired appearance.
Measure the area (length x width) and decide the depth you need, then convert to cubic yards or tons using an online calculator or our material calculator. Different materials have different densities, so convert volume to weight before ordering and add 5-10% extra for grading, compaction, and waste. Materials that drain well and lock together tend to perform better through freeze-thaw cycles, so well-graded, angular aggregates that compact tightly are often preferred for driveways and walkways. Fine, powdery materials can wash out or rut when freeze-thaw and winter traffic occur, so combine good drainage planning with the right gradation to reduce maintenance. Consider top dressing and periodic regrading to extend the life of the surface.
Rural deliveries can involve county road weight limits, gated or private roads, and HOA or local permitting, so check local rules before scheduling. Large trucks may need to follow posted weight restrictions or obtain permits for travel on certain roads, and narrow or steep driveways may prevent safe truck access. Durable, well-draining materials that match the intended use reduce maintenance frequency and long-term costs; for example, structural aggregates mean less frequent regrading and fewer potholes. Materials that migrate or compact poorly will need more topping, reshaping, and edging over time. Consider initial compaction, drainage, and thickness to minimize future upkeep costs.
For erosion control, heavier, angular stone or properly sized rock placed with a stable base and vegetation is commonly used, along with geotextiles where appropriate. The right gradation and placement help slow flow and reduce soil loss, but solutions vary by slope, soil type, and water flow. For projects near waterways, check local regulations and consider professional design to protect both property and the environment.

Common mistakes include ordering the wrong gradation or depth, skipping compaction, ignoring drainage, and underestimating extra material for waste and settling. Also avoid placing materials directly on soft, wet ground without proper base preparation, and don’t assume tailgate spreading is guaranteed; drivers decide based on safety. Plan for access, compaction equipment, and drainage to get a lasting result.
